Falken Tire releases first self-sealing tire: The EuroAll Season AS210

Sumitomo Rubber announced that Falken Tire Europe has released to market the first tire to feature its proprietary CORESEAL sealant tire technology, which prevents air leakage caused by damage to the tread of a tire.

Initially available on two sizes of Falken’s all-season EuroAll Season AS210 pattern, CORESEAL prevents air pressure loss due to punctures by automatically sealing any punctures up to five millimetres in the tread surface, offering convenience, cost and safety to drivers.

Falken’s proprietary CORESEAL technology features a layer of highly adhesive, yet viscous sealant on the inner lining of the tire. If the tire is punctured, the sealant automatically flows into the hole and thus prevents further loss of air pressure. CORESEAL avoids the hassle and safety issues of experiencing a puncture.

“CORESEAL is a simple solution to a disruptive problem,” says Andreas Giese, senior manager corporate planning/product planning at Falken Tire Europe. “Now you no longer have to change a tire or wait for roadside assistance, you can simply continue your journey. CORESEAL is a significant step in making tires smarter and more efficient.”

On sale in Germany from July 2021, Falken will initially offer 235/55R18 104V XL followed by the 225/50R17 98V XL all-season EUROALL SEASON AS210.

Falken recommends the use of a tire pressure monitoring system with its CORESEAL tires and suggests any puncture should be checked by a tire professional.
